Packing everything up

One of the most important things people forget to do when moving is packing everything up. Make sure to pack up all of your belongings, including clothes, dishes, furniture, and anything else you need to bring with you. If you’re hiring a moving company, be sure to ask about their packing services and what type of insurance they have in case something is damaged during the move.

One of the most important things to do when you’re packing up for a move is to label all of your boxes. This may seem like a tedious task, but it will save you a lot of time and frustration in the long run. When you label your boxes, be sure to include what is inside each one as well as the destination room. That way, you won’t have to guess where everything goes when you arrive at your new home.

Additionally, it’s a good idea to pack a few essential items in a separate bag that you can easily access during the move. This could include things like snacks, bottled water, medications, and a change of clothes. By taking the time to pack carefully, you can make the moving process much smoother and less stressful.

Change of address

Moving to a new home is an exciting time. However, it’s important to remember to change your address with the post office. This way, you’ll ensure that you continue to receive important mail such as bills, statements, and packages. Additionally, changing your address will help prevent identity theft.

When you move, criminals may try to obtain your personal information by submitting a change of address form in your name. By changing your address yourself, you can help protect yourself from identity theft and other scams. So, whether you’re moving across town or the country, don’t forget to change your address with the post office. It’s an important step in making sure your move goes smoothly.

Cleaning the old place

Anytime you move, it’s important to take the time to clean your old place from top to bottom. Not only will this help you get your deposit back, but it will also give you a sense of closure as you move on to the next phase of your life. When it comes to cleaning, there are a few key areas that you’ll want to focus on. First, make sure to thoroughly clean all surfaces, including the kitchen and bathroom.

This means scrubbing sinks, toilets, countertops, and floors until they shine. Next, vacuum or sweep all floors and dust all surfaces. Finally, Take out all trash and recycling, and be sure to wipe down any cabinets or drawers that you used during your stay. By taking the time to clean your old place before you go, you’ll be able to start fresh in your new home.
